技术文摘
C++ 能不能成为你的新脚本语言
2024-12-31 17:20:28 小编
C++ 能不能成为你的新脚本语言
在编程的广阔世界里,脚本语言以其简洁、灵活的特性备受青睐。而C++,作为一种强大的通用编程语言,是否有潜力成为你的新脚本语言呢?
C++有着强大的性能优势。它经过高度优化的编译器和底层控制能力,使得代码的执行效率极高。与一些传统脚本语言相比,C++编写的程序在运行速度上往往有着显著的提升。对于那些对性能要求苛刻的应用场景,如游戏开发、实时系统等,C++的高效性无疑是一大亮点。例如,许多大型3D游戏的核心引擎就是用C++编写的,以确保流畅的游戏体验。
C++拥有丰富的标准库和各种第三方库。这些库提供了大量的功能模块,从数据结构到网络通信,从图形处理到文件操作,几乎涵盖了编程的各个方面。开发者可以借助这些库快速实现复杂的功能,减少了开发的时间和工作量。
然而,C++也并非毫无缺点。它的语法相对复杂,学习曲线较陡。与一些简单易学的脚本语言相比,初学者可能需要花费更多的时间和精力来掌握C++的基本概念和编程技巧。而且,C++的代码编写和调试过程相对繁琐,需要更多的注意细节和严谨性。
但随着技术的不断发展,一些工具和框架的出现也在逐渐改善C++作为脚本语言的使用体验。比如,一些轻量级的C++脚本引擎,使得在不牺牲性能的前提下,能够更方便地编写和运行C++脚本。
C++有成为新脚本语言的潜力。对于有一定编程基础,且对性能和功能有较高要求的开发者来说,C++是一个值得考虑的选择。尽管它存在一些学习和使用上的挑战,但通过不断的学习和实践,以及借助相关工具和框架,C++可以在脚本编程领域发挥出巨大的优势,为开发者带来更高效、更强大的编程体验。如果你愿意挑战自我,追求更高的编程性能,不妨尝试让C++成为你的新脚本语言。
- Python文件复制中相关文件复制的实际操作方法
- Python操作文件时查看目录内容的具体方法
- Python分解路径名典型例子及实际操作解说
- Python文件详细信息介绍及具体分析
- Python目录的创建与移动及典型例子解析
- Visual Studio 2010不为人知的新特性
- Python遍历目录树中函数调用的实际操作步骤简析
- Java Socket编程中两者关系的建立方法
- Python中os模块在递归文件中的实际应用方案简介
- Python os.getcwd()函数实际应用方案解析
- Python os.mkdir()函数创建目录的实操方案
- Python编程语言目录内容获取及创建目录方案介绍
- RIA之争:微软Adobe坚信HTML 5难一枝独秀
- OSGi:Java模块化框架的别样进化
- Visual Stuido 2010中VC++新特征盘点